make/windows/makefiles/defs.make
Index Unified diffs Context diffs Sdiffs Wdiffs Patch New Old Previous File Next File hotspot-npg Sdiff make/windows/makefiles

make/windows/makefiles/defs.make

Print this page




 137 else
 138   # debug variants always get Full Debug Symbols (if available)
 139   ENABLE_FULL_DEBUG_SYMBOLS = 1
 140 endif
 141 _JUNK_ := $(shell \
 142   echo >&2 "INFO: ENABLE_FULL_DEBUG_SYMBOLS=$(ENABLE_FULL_DEBUG_SYMBOLS)")
 143 MAKE_ARGS += ENABLE_FULL_DEBUG_SYMBOLS=$(ENABLE_FULL_DEBUG_SYMBOLS)
 144 
 145 ifeq ($(ENABLE_FULL_DEBUG_SYMBOLS),1)
 146   ZIP_DEBUGINFO_FILES ?= 1
 147 else
 148   ZIP_DEBUGINFO_FILES=0
 149 endif
 150 MAKE_ARGS += ZIP_DEBUGINFO_FILES=$(ZIP_DEBUGINFO_FILES)
 151 MAKE_ARGS += RM="$(RM)"
 152 MAKE_ARGS += ZIPEXE=$(ZIPEXE)
 153 
 154 # On 32 bit windows we build server, client and kernel, on 64 bit just server.
 155 ifeq ($(JVM_VARIANTS),)
 156   ifeq ($(ARCH_DATA_MODEL), 32)
 157     JVM_VARIANTS:=client,server,kernel
 158     JVM_VARIANT_CLIENT:=true
 159     JVM_VARIANT_SERVER:=true
 160     JVM_VARIANT_KERNEL:=true
 161   else
 162     JVM_VARIANTS:=server
 163     JVM_VARIANT_SERVER:=true
 164   endif
 165 endif
 166 
 167 JDK_INCLUDE_SUBDIR=win32
 168 
 169 # Library suffix
 170 LIBRARY_SUFFIX=dll
 171 
 172 # HOTSPOT_RELEASE_VERSION and HOTSPOT_BUILD_VERSION are defined
 173 # and added to MAKE_ARGS list in $(GAMMADIR)/make/defs.make.
 174 
 175 # next parameters are defined in $(GAMMADIR)/make/defs.make.
 176 MAKE_ARGS += JDK_MKTG_VERSION=$(JDK_MKTG_VERSION)
 177 MAKE_ARGS += JDK_MAJOR_VER=$(JDK_MAJOR_VERSION)
 178 MAKE_ARGS += JDK_MINOR_VER=$(JDK_MINOR_VERSION)
 179 MAKE_ARGS += JDK_MICRO_VER=$(JDK_MICRO_VERSION)
 180 




 137 else
 138   # debug variants always get Full Debug Symbols (if available)
 139   ENABLE_FULL_DEBUG_SYMBOLS = 1
 140 endif
 141 _JUNK_ := $(shell \
 142   echo >&2 "INFO: ENABLE_FULL_DEBUG_SYMBOLS=$(ENABLE_FULL_DEBUG_SYMBOLS)")
 143 MAKE_ARGS += ENABLE_FULL_DEBUG_SYMBOLS=$(ENABLE_FULL_DEBUG_SYMBOLS)
 144 
 145 ifeq ($(ENABLE_FULL_DEBUG_SYMBOLS),1)
 146   ZIP_DEBUGINFO_FILES ?= 1
 147 else
 148   ZIP_DEBUGINFO_FILES=0
 149 endif
 150 MAKE_ARGS += ZIP_DEBUGINFO_FILES=$(ZIP_DEBUGINFO_FILES)
 151 MAKE_ARGS += RM="$(RM)"
 152 MAKE_ARGS += ZIPEXE=$(ZIPEXE)
 153 
 154 # On 32 bit windows we build server, client and kernel, on 64 bit just server.
 155 ifeq ($(JVM_VARIANTS),)
 156   ifeq ($(ARCH_DATA_MODEL), 32)
 157     JVM_VARIANTS:=client,server
 158     JVM_VARIANT_CLIENT:=true
 159     JVM_VARIANT_SERVER:=true

 160   else
 161     JVM_VARIANTS:=server
 162     JVM_VARIANT_SERVER:=true
 163   endif
 164 endif
 165 
 166 JDK_INCLUDE_SUBDIR=win32
 167 
 168 # Library suffix
 169 LIBRARY_SUFFIX=dll
 170 
 171 # HOTSPOT_RELEASE_VERSION and HOTSPOT_BUILD_VERSION are defined
 172 # and added to MAKE_ARGS list in $(GAMMADIR)/make/defs.make.
 173 
 174 # next parameters are defined in $(GAMMADIR)/make/defs.make.
 175 MAKE_ARGS += JDK_MKTG_VERSION=$(JDK_MKTG_VERSION)
 176 MAKE_ARGS += JDK_MAJOR_VER=$(JDK_MAJOR_VERSION)
 177 MAKE_ARGS += JDK_MINOR_VER=$(JDK_MINOR_VERSION)
 178 MAKE_ARGS += JDK_MICRO_VER=$(JDK_MICRO_VERSION)
 179 


make/windows/makefiles/defs.make
Index Unified diffs Context diffs Sdiffs Wdiffs Patch New Old Previous File Next File